Isabella Mandich moved from Los Angeles to London for university. With an interest in food and local culture, she wanted to create a business that would make a positive impact in her community.
LocalMeal is an online platform designed to help adventurous foodies discover delicious, independently owned restaurants. The idea originated from a group assignment during her studies, but she decided to turn it into a business after discovering that people struggled to find authentic, local places when travelling.
Isabella has a high-fidelity working prototype which has been tested with users. It’s currently undergoing a second round of beta development and already has a waitlist of over 500 people.
“I feel proud to be a Young Innovator because building a startup at 21 years old is an unusual and challenging path – most of my peers are looking towards more traditional ‘stable’ jobs. This Award gives me the confidence and motivation to highlight to others that being a startup founder is a valuable and rewarding experience,” she says.
